Ring and Pinion

time for some new gears! after that zf 5 swap im bogged after every shift...the 4.10s and 38s dont seem to like each other.

first question "yukon" vs. "g2" any reviews or feedback?

second question 4.88s or 5.13s? i have 38s right now tallest ill go is 40s

local shop (randys ring and pinion) wants $600 for just the gears (front and rear) and 4wheelparts wants just over $400 (front and rear)

the front is a 88 dana 60 and the rear is a 97 10.25. i spend alot of time in the 35-55mph range, not too many stop lights in my little town lol

ive done gears before and ill get the other parts from a local parts store (know the owner get good deals )

i was leaning toward the 4.88s, what do you guys think?

I'm thinking I would go with 4.88, that would put at 25 in 5th and 32 in 4th at 75 mph, and you could cruise at 22 something at 65 mph. 5.13's would be close to 200 more rpm's and might suit you better if you go to 40's on tire height.

oh yeah i see.you turned her right into a slug without gears and no more converter either..

4.88's is good.
since the tires are so heavy,and the speeds you listed driving at most often 35-55 plus may go 40" and now with a manual trans,id personally go with the 5.13's if possible,if not the 4.88's will still be decent enough you wont be burning up your clutch.5.13's so much more desirable for the setup,tires,and main driving speeds though imho.


"My 93 has 410s and 31s that is a little too high for me"
too low you mean? or? (revs too high?)
stock tires are 31.7".


1991 f250
38" w/ 4.10's right now = 3.42 gearing.
38" w/ 4.88's = 4.07 = back where it belongs.would be just like the 91 truck pretty much,but with less pep in her step due to large heavy tires.
40" w/4.88's = 3.86 starts to bring her up a bit.(hey close to where im at.this is a nice sweet spot for these speeds,though if anything,sometimes i wish i where lower to have a little more rpms at 45mph.1350 rpms is pretty low.plenty of pulling grunt but iv got the E40D.you lost your converter.
38" w/ 5.13 = 4.28 - this right here,would most likely "feel" pretty close to how the 91 truck sits.a little more gearing to compensate for those heavy sneakers.
40" w/ 5.13 = 4.07 - i wouldn't want any less gearing than this with a manual trans,heavy 40" tires and main speeds of 35-55mph.it would go ok though.still feel less snappy than the '91 truck but go pretty well around town no problem.

if you know 40" tires will be sitting under her some day,your main speeds will be 35-55 then try your best to score the 5.13's.
